Location--access
Vaison-la-Romaine is located in southern France in the Vaucluse
departement, just east of the Rhone River, 2 hours north of
the Mediterranean, along the Ouvèze River (see
maps.) Vaison is a sophisticated town, and many Parisians
and foreigners call it home, at least for part of the year.
The locals are very friendly and courteous to visitors. Vaison
has important Roman ruins (hence its name "la Romaine")
Coming from the north, Paris is a 2 hour 40 min trip by
TGV to Avignon, then a one hour drive north from the Avignon
TGV station; or a half hour from the Orange TGV station.
The Lyon airport (i.e. Saint-Exupéry) is a three hour
drive south to Vaison.
From the south, Vaison is a 1.5 hour drive north from the
Marseille Airport (i.e. Marignane.)
